What to check before for buildings with high tenant retention near the B train in Hamilton Heights

  • Filter meaning: “b-train” is about proximity to the B line area, and “high-retention” highlights buildings that tend to keep tenants longer (lower turnover).
  • Shortlist what matters to you: confirm lease start flexibility, laundry, packages, noise (especially for street-facing units), and any building rules that affect daily life.
  • Ask for move-in specifics in writing: total monthly cost beyond the rent (deposit, fees, and any utility responsibilities), plus whether renewals are offered consistently.
  • Check the unit details that retention doesn’t guarantee: rent changes on renewal, available floor plans, and current availability near your desired move date.
  • Use reviews and tenant Q&A to verify the pattern: look for repeated mentions of responsiveness, maintenance timelines, and management consistency—not just a single data point.
